**Q: How do visiting contractors enter through the shuttle-bus gate at the Larkmoor campus?**

A: The shuttle-bus gate on the east perimeter is the only approved entry point for contractors arriving on the Vellora Transit loop. Please remain on the bus until it has fully stopped inside the holding lane, then present your signed work order to the gate attendant. The attendant will verify your name against the day's contractor roster before waving the bus through. Once cleared, you will need the current gate pass code, shown below.

turnstile pass: bdg-QZV-3

Minutes — Management Meeting, Ferndale Cartage Ltd.

Present: full executive team. Single agenda item: fleet insurance renewal. Broker quoted a 14% premium increase citing claims history at the Dunmore depot. Alternatives reviewed; two carriers shortlisted. Agreed: raise deductibles on older vehicles, bundle cargo cover, finalize within three weeks. Claims-reduction training mandated for all depot supervisors. Risk register to be updated. Renewal strategy considerations for the board are recorded confidentially below.

board note of baguf-fafog: Kasixox Foods plans to lower the Drueth list price by 48 percent in March.

# Break-Glass: Catalog Cache Invalidation

Scope: the Pinrow product catalog at Veldstone Retail. If stale prices persist after a purge and the Hollowmere invalidation queue is wedged, use break-glass to flush the edge tier directly. Contractors: get verbal sign-off from the catalog lead first. Steps: open the Hollowmere admin shell, select emergency-flush, confirm the tenant, and run it once — repeated flushes thrash the origin. Access is logged and expires after 20 minutes. Unseal the admin shell with the passphrase below.

recovery phrase for kahop-tajog: istix-casvan

The garage occupancy feed for the Brindlewood campus arrives over a message queue every thirty seconds, one record per level, published by the Stallgrid edge boxes. Counts can briefly go negative when a sensor double-fires on exit; the ingest job clamps these to zero and flags the interval. If the feed stalls for more than five minutes, the dashboard falls back to the last known snapshot. Sensor mappings, queue names, and the replay procedure are documented on the internal page below.

runbook for tahog-kadug: https://gitlab.qirvanworks.corp/projects/pages/view/b139298aed28